What is GMB Union

Overview

GMB Union is a UK trade union founded in 1889 that represents workers across multiple sectors. It offers representation, negotiating power, legal advice and member services funded through membership dues. GMB is governed by an internal rulebook which sets out resignation procedures. See the official rulebook for details: GMB Rulebook 2024.

Who it is for

GMB targets employees, part-time workers, apprentices, students in certain circumstances and retired members. The union states it represents ‘‘all workers across various industries and professions" and offers graded subscription rates for different working situations.

How it works

Members pay weekly or monthly dues by direct debit or payroll deduction in exchange for representation, legal advice and campaigning. Rule 41 sets out leaving procedures and regional offices handle membership changes. The union may contact members to verify identity before confirming cancellation.

How to cancel GMB Union

Web (online member area)

  1. Log in to the GMB member area if you have an account.
  2. Attempt to access the cancellation option and follow any on-screen prompts to cancel.
  3. If the site asks you to email a department, send the email as instructed and keep copies.
  4. Wait for an email confirmation from GMB. If you do not receive confirmation within 7 days, follow up in writing.

Email

  1. Compose a written notice including your full name, membership number (if known), address, and a clear statement that you wish to cancel membership with at least 14 days notice under Rule 41 Clause 5.
  2. Send to the main support email or the specific cancellation address GMB provides.
  3. Keep a copy of the sent email and request a confirmation reply. Keep that confirmation as proof.

Post (registered letter)

  1. Write a signed letter stating your intention to cancel and include membership details.
  2. Send by recorded or registered delivery to the head office: GMB Union, 152 Brent Street, NW4 2DP London, United Kingdom.
  3. Keep the delivery receipt and wait 14 days from the date of receipt for the cancellation to take effect. Ask GMB for written confirmation.

Phone

  1. Call the GMB contact number if you have one (not publicly disclosed by GMB in the research).
  2. Report that you want to cancel and note any reference number provided.
  3. Immediately follow up with a written notice (email or post) because Rule 41 requires written notice to a regional office.

Direct debit and payroll deductions

  1. Send your written cancellation notice to GMB first so you are not treated as a lapsed member with unpaid arrears.
  2. After you have sent written notice to GMB, you may cancel the direct debit with your bank. If an incorrect payment is taken, use the Direct Debit Guarantee to secure a full refund from your bank.
  3. If dues are deducted via employer payroll, notify both GMB and your employer payroll or HR department in writing and request payroll stop and repayment of any overpaid amount.

Cancel by reason

Moving / change of address

If you move and no longer require membership, send a written resignation including your new address and membership details. Proof documents accepted: copy of utility bill or tenancy agreement showing new address. Legal basis: Section 69, Trade Union and Labour Relations (Consolidation) Act 1992.

Price increase

If GMB raises subscription rates and you wish to leave for that reason, submit written notice citing the price increase and the date you wish to leave. Proof documents accepted: copy of GMB notification or webpage showing the new rate and date. Legal basis: Consumer Contracts Regulations 2013 and Consumer Rights Act 2015 where applicable.

Death of subscriber

Next of kin should notify GMB in writing, provide a copy of the death certificate and request termination of membership and any refund for overpayment. Proof required: certified copy of death certificate. Legal basis: Section 69, Trade Union and Labour Relations (Consolidation) Act 1992.

Legitimate ground (representation no longer required)

GMB accepts resignations for reasons such as leaving employment, retirement or moving abroad. Proof documents accepted: proof of new employment status, pension letter or visa/work permit. Legal basis: Rule 41 and Section 69 of the Trade Union and Labour Relations (Consolidation) Act 1992.

End of commitment or change in circumstances

If your working hours change and you move to a different contribution band, send written notice and enclose payslips or a letter from your employer showing the new hours. GMB will reclassify your subscription or cancel membership on receipt of appropriate proof.

Cooling-off (new members who joined online)

If you joined online, you may have rights under the Consumer Contracts Regulations 2013 to a 14-day cooling-off period for contracts concluded off-premises or online. If you exercise the right to cancel within 14 days, provide the date of join and request a refund where applicable. If digital content was accessed with consent, the exception may apply. Legal basis: Consumer Contracts Regulations 2013.

What to do after cancelling GMB Union

Confirm cancellation and keep proof

Keep the confirmation email, recorded delivery receipt or bank statement showing the cancellation. If GMB does not send confirmation within 14 days, follow up in writing and keep copies.

Direct debit and payroll follow-up

If GMB takes a payment after your cancellation date, use the Direct Debit Guarantee to request a full refund from your bank. If deductions continue via payroll, provide your employer with written notice and proof of your resignation to request repayment of overpaid sums in your next payslip.

Data and rejoining

If you want your data removed, send a specific request to [email protected]. Rejoining is usually permitted by taking out a new membership; check the GMB rulebook and membership terms. For disputes about representation or refunds, retain all correspondence and consider escalation routes outlined in the legal protections block.

Next steps and practical checklist

Follow this checklist to make sure cancellation is effective and you keep proof.

  • Write a signed cancellation notice with name, address and membership details.
  • Send notice by email and by recorded post to GMB Union, 152 Brent Street, NW4 2DP London, United Kingdom.
  • Keep copies of sent emails and recorded delivery receipts.
  • Wait 14 days after GMB acknowledges receipt for the cancellation to take effect.
  • If paying by direct debit, cancel the instruction with your bank only after sending written notice to GMB.
  • If deductions are via payroll, notify your employer payroll/HR department in writing.
  • If you receive a payment after cancellation, request a refund from GMB. If refused, use the Direct Debit Guarantee or raise a bank chargeback.
